Understanding Bacteriostatic Water

Bacteriostatic water is a sterile water solution that contains a small percentage of benzyl alcohol, making it suitable for injection purposes. This water acts as a diluent for medications that require reconstitution before administration.

The Importance of Sterility

One of the primary attributes of bacteriostatic water is its sterility. The manufacturing of this water adheres to strict guidelines, ensuring that it is free from contaminants. This is essential because introducing non-sterile water into the body can lead to serious complications, including infections.

Applications in Medicine

Bacteriostatic water is essential in various medical applications:

  • Medication Dilution: It is primarily used to dilute medications for injection.
  • Extended Shelf Life: The presence of benzyl alcohol helps to prolong the shelf life of medications after they have been reconstituted.
  • Compatibility: It is compatible with many injectable drugs, making it a preferred choice in hospitals and clinics.

The Role of Semaglutide in Weight Loss

Semaglutide is a groundbreaking medication that has emerged as a powerful aid in the battle against obesity. Originally developed for the treatment of type 2 diabetes, its weight loss benefits are drawing significant attention.

Mechanism of Action

Semaglutide mimics the action of a gut hormone known as GLP-1 (glucagon-like peptide-1). It plays a pivotal role in managing blood sugar levels and, notably, regulating appetite.
